Tivan Limited ( (AU:TVN) ) has provided an announcement.
Tivan Limited has signed a Memorandum of Understanding with Sumitomo Corporation for the collaborative development of the Sandover Fluorite Project in the Northern Territory. This agreement marks the second collaboration between the two companies, highlighting a strong strategic relationship and advancing Tivan’s position in the emerging fluorite sector in Australia. The project aims to support the production of metspar and acid-grade fluorspar, which are critical for sectors like lithium-ion batteries and semiconductor manufacturing. The agreement is expected to strengthen bilateral relations between Australia and Japan in critical minerals, with Tivan progressing towards defining a fluorite deposit to support mining operations.
More about Tivan Limited
Tivan Limited, headquartered in Darwin, operates in the mining industry with a focus on developing high-grade fluorite projects in Australia. The company has been enhancing its project facilitation capabilities in the Northern Territory and has acquired significant fluorite resources, aiming to produce metspar and acid-grade fluorspar.
